> Spraying garbage all over source code destroys editor agnosticism, even
> if some editor exists that can hide all the crap like trailing
> whitespace, spaces where tabs belong, and screwed-up indentation. Use
> emacs all you want. Don't force others to use some particular editor by
> spewing garbage all over the kernel source that requires some special
> editor to hide.
